菜单优化
This commit is contained in:
@@ -69,13 +69,17 @@ public class OrderUtil {
|
|||||||
@Async("threadPoolTaskExecutor")
|
@Async("threadPoolTaskExecutor")
|
||||||
public void orderToWxBatch(List<OrderRow> orderRowList) {
|
public void orderToWxBatch(List<OrderRow> orderRowList) {
|
||||||
if (!orderRowList.isEmpty()) {
|
if (!orderRowList.isEmpty()) {
|
||||||
|
int i = 1;
|
||||||
String wxId = getWxidFromJdid(orderRowList.get(0).getUnionId().toString());
|
String wxId = getWxidFromJdid(orderRowList.get(0).getUnionId().toString());
|
||||||
StringBuilder content = new StringBuilder();
|
StringBuilder content = new StringBuilder();
|
||||||
|
content.append("批量订单: ").append(orderRowList.size()).append("单 \r\n");
|
||||||
for (OrderRow orderRow : orderRowList) {
|
for (OrderRow orderRow : orderRowList) {
|
||||||
String oldValidCode = redisTemplate.opsForValue().get(ORDER_ROW_KEY + orderRow.getId());
|
String oldValidCode = redisTemplate.opsForValue().get(ORDER_ROW_KEY + orderRow.getId());
|
||||||
|
|
||||||
// 检查Redis中是否有旧的状态码,没有的话赋予默认值
|
// 检查Redis中是否有旧的状态码,没有的话赋予默认值
|
||||||
Integer lastValidCode = oldValidCode != null ? Integer.parseInt(oldValidCode) : -100;
|
Integer lastValidCode = oldValidCode != null ? Integer.parseInt(oldValidCode) : -100;
|
||||||
|
content.append("\r\n");
|
||||||
|
content.append(i++).append("、");
|
||||||
content.append(getFormattedOrderInfo(orderRow, lastValidCode));
|
content.append(getFormattedOrderInfo(orderRow, lastValidCode));
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|||||||
Reference in New Issue
Block a user